The Evolution of Light: Understanding COB Technology
To truly appreciate the breakthrough that is COB technology, it's helpful to look back at its predecessor, the SMD (Surface Mounted Device) LED strip. For a long time, SMD strips were the standard for linear LED lighting. You've likely seen them everywhere. They consist of individual LED chips (like the common 2835 or 5050 types) soldered onto a flexible printed circuit board (PCB) at regular intervals. While they revolutionized lighting with their flexibility and efficiency, they had one significant aesthetic drawback: hotspots.
No matter how closely you packed the SMD chips, at close viewing distances or when reflected on a glossy surface, you could always see the individual points of light. This "string of pearls" effect could be distracting and cheapen an otherwise high-end design. Designers had to employ deep aluminum channels with thick diffusers to try and blend the light, often sacrificing brightness and efficiency in the process. It was a compromise, not a solution.
Enter Chip On Board (COB) technology. COB turns the entire concept on its head. Instead of mounting individual, packaged LEDs, COB technology involves bonding a multitude of tiny, bare LED chips directly onto the flexible PCB. These chips are packed together in an incredibly high density, far closer than any SMD strip could achieve. Then, the entire array is covered with a continuous layer of phosphor. The result? When you power it on, you don't see individual dots. You see a single, uniform, and uninterrupted line of light. It's the difference between seeing a series of separate campfires from a distance and seeing the solid, glowing line of a horizon at sunset. The light source itself becomes the clean line, eliminating the need for heavy diffusion.
This innovative manufacturing process delivers more than just aesthetic perfection. It brings a host of technical advantages:
- Superior Thermal Management: Because the chips are bonded directly to the PCB, heat is transferred away from the chips much more efficiently. Better heat dissipation means a longer lifespan, more stable color over time, and enhanced reliability—cornerstones of the HansonLed quality promise.
- Higher Light Density: By eliminating the packaging around each individual LED, COB technology allows for a much greater number of light-emitting sources per inch. This not only contributes to the seamless look but also allows for incredibly bright outputs from a very narrow strip.
- Wider Beam Angle: Traditional SMD LEDs have a more focused beam angle, typically around 120 degrees. COB strips, with their flat, continuous emitting surface, create a much softer light with a wider beam angle, often up to 180 degrees. This creates a more even and gentle wash of light, perfect for indirect and ambient lighting applications.

The Significance of the White PCB
While it might seem like a minor detail, the color of the printed circuit board is a deliberate design choice. The "White PCB" in our product's name is crucial for achieving truly invisible installations. In many applications, especially within white or light-colored coves, channels, or cabinetry, a white PCB blends in seamlessly when the lights are off. A darker PCB would create a visible dark line, disrupting the clean aesthetic of the space. Furthermore, the white surface acts as a subtle reflector, bouncing some of the light produced by the chips upwards and outwards, which can contribute to a slight increase in overall luminous efficiency and a fuller glow. It's a small detail that makes a big difference in high-end projects.

Decoding the Specifications: What the Numbers Mean for You
Technical specifications can seem daunting, but they are the key to understanding a product's performance and suitability for your project. Let's break down the key features of our White PCB COB LED Strip and translate them into real-world benefits.
| Feature | Specification (Typical) | What This Means For You |
|---|---|---|
| LED Density | 480+ chips/meter | Guarantees a completely uniform, dotless line of light. The high density ensures maximum smoothness and brightness, eliminating the need for a diffuser in most applications. |
| Color Rendering Index (CRI) | Ra > 90 | Your colors will look true and vibrant. A high CRI is essential for retail (showcasing products), kitchens (food appearance), closets (choosing outfits), and art galleries. Lower CRI values can make objects appear dull and washed out. |
| Luminous Efficacy | ~100 lumens/watt | Exceptional efficiency. You get brilliant light while consuming less energy. This aligns with our mission as a "green lighting" enterprise, saving you money on electricity bills and reducing your environmental footprint. |
| Operating Voltage | 24V DC | Allows for longer continuous runs with less voltage drop compared to 12V strips. This means more consistent brightness from the beginning of the strip to the end, simplifying wiring for large-scale projects. |
| PCB Width | 8mm / 10mm | A versatile width that fits into most standard aluminum channels and is slim enough for discreet, custom installations in tight spaces. |
| Color Temperatures (CCT) | 2700K - 6500K | A full range of white light options. Choose warm white (~3000K) for a cozy, inviting atmosphere in living rooms and bedrooms, or cool white (~5000K) for clear, energetic task lighting in offices and garages. |
| IP Rating | IP20 (Indoor) | Perfectly suited for dry, indoor environments like living rooms, bedrooms, offices, and commercial interiors. Other IP ratings for damp or wet locations are available for specialized applications. |
Understanding these specs empowers you to make informed decisions. A high CRI of 90+ is not a luxury; it's a necessity for any space where color accuracy matters. The move to 24V is a professional standard that simplifies installation and ensures a better-quality result, especially on runs longer than 5 meters. Unleashing Creativity: Applications and Design Ideas
The true beauty of the White PCB COB LED Strip lies in its versatility. Its ability to provide seamless, high-quality light opens up a universe of creative possibilities for both residential and commercial spaces. Let's explore some of the ways this product can transform an environment.
Transforming Residential Spaces
- Architectural Cove Lighting: This is the quintessential application for COB strips. Installed in a ledge near the ceiling, it casts a soft, indirect glow upwards, making the ceiling feel higher and the room feel more spacious and open. The dot-free output ensures the effect is elegant and sophisticated, not cheap.
- Under-Cabinet Kitchen Lighting: Say goodbye to annoying reflections of LED dots on your polished granite or quartz countertops. A COB strip provides a perfect, uniform sheet of light across your workspace, making food prep easier and showcasing your beautiful surfaces. The high CRI will make your food look more appetizing too!
- Integrated Shelf and Bookcase Lighting: Mill a small groove into the underside of your shelves and press-fit a COB strip. The result is a stunning "floating shelf" effect where the light seems to emanate from the structure itself, beautifully highlighting the objects on display without any visible fixtures.
- Stairway and Hallway Safety Lighting: Installed under the handrail or beneath the lip of each stair tread, the COB strip provides a gentle, continuous line of light that guides the way safely in the dark, adding a dramatic and modern architectural element.
- Bedroom Ambiance: Create a stunning floating bed effect by installing a strip around the underside of the bed frame. Or, use it behind a headboard to create a soft, relaxing halo of light perfect for winding down at the end of the day.

Installation Guide: Best Practices for a Perfect Finish
Achieving a professional-grade installation is straightforward with the right approach. While the COB strip is forgiving thanks to its dotless nature, following these best practices will ensure optimal performance and longevity for your project.
1. Surface Preparation is Key
The 3M adhesive backing on our strips is incredibly strong, but it needs a clean, dry surface to bond properly. Before application, thoroughly wipe down the mounting surface with isopropyl alcohol to remove any dust, oil, or residue. For porous surfaces like raw wood or plaster, it's a good idea to seal or prime them first to create a smooth, stable base.
2. Cutting and Connecting
Our COB strips are designed to be cut to your desired length. Look for the clearly marked cut lines, typically every 40-50mm. Always use a sharp pair of scissors to ensure a clean cut through the center of the copper pads. For joining sections or adding power leads, you have two options:
- Solderless Connectors: These are a quick and easy solution for DIYers. Simply open the connector, slide the strip end in under the metal contacts, and snap it shut. Ensure you buy the correct connector for your strip's width (e.g., 8mm or 10mm) and pin count.
- Soldering: For the most secure and reliable long-term connection, soldering is the professional's choice. A quick, clean solder joint on the copper pads will provide the best electrical conductivity and mechanical strength.
3. Powering Your Project Correctly
Choosing the right power supply (also called a driver) is critical. Our strips operate on 24V DC, so you must use a 24V driver. To calculate the required size, multiply the strip's power consumption per meter (in watts) by the total length of your run. Then, add a 20% buffer. For example, if your total wattage is 80W, choose a 100W driver (80W * 1.2 = 96W). This "80% rule" prevents the driver from being overworked, ensuring its longevity and safety.
4. The Role of Aluminum Channels
One of the best features of COB is that you don't *need* a diffuser to get a smooth line of light. However, using an aluminum channel or profile is still highly recommended for several reasons:
- Heat Sink: The aluminum acts as a heat sink, drawing heat away from the strip. This keeps the LEDs running cooler, which significantly extends their lifespan and maintains color consistency.
- Protection: The channel and its cover protect the strip from dust, moisture, and physical damage.
- Aesthetics: Even if the strip itself is hidden, a channel provides a clean, finished housing for the light, which speaks to a high-quality installation.
